什么是持续集成(CI-Continuous integration)
持续集成是指多名开发者在开发不同功能代码的过程当中,可以频繁的将代码行合并到一起并切相互不影响工作。
什么是持续部署(CD-continuous deployment)
是基于某种工具或平台实现代码自动化的构建、测试和部署到线上环境以实现交付高质量的产品,持续部署在某种程度上代表了一个开发团队的更新迭代速率。
什么是持续交付(Continuous Delivery)
持续交付是在持续部署的基础之上,将产品交付到线上环境,因此持续交付是产品价值的一种交付,是产品价值的一种盈利的实现。
常见的部署方式
- 开发自己上传–最原始的方案
- 开发给运维手动上传–运维自己手动部署
- 运维使用脚本复制–半自动化
- 结合web界面一键部署–自动化
本文链接:http://www.yunweipai.com/35643.html
原创文章,作者:ItWorker,如若转载,请注明出处:https://blog.ytso.com/52597.html